TUNGALOY-6848776

  • Item # TUNGALOY-6848776
  • Brand: TUNGALOY AMERICA INCORPORATED

Price: $283.100 each

Call for stock

E08K-STUPL07-D080
S.CARBIDE SHANK TUNGTURN TLS #6848776